报表工具iReport
1星 需积分: 0 128 浏览量
更新于2008-01-17
收藏 2.11MB DOC 举报
iReport报表工具
iReport是一款功能强大、直观、易于使用的可视化报表设计器,用于设计和生成各种复杂报表。下面是iReport的详细介绍和使用指南。
iReport简介
iReport是一个开源的报表工具,用于设计和生成各种复杂报表。它采用纯Java开发,支持多种输出格式,包括PDF、HTML、RTF、Excel、XML、XLS、CSV、HTM等。iReport还集成了JFreeChart图表制作包,用于生成各种图表。
iReport的优点
* 开源软件,网上文档比较多
* 使用方便、易于上手使用
* 配置简单
* 支持各种报表和图表输入格式,方便打印
iReport的安装
iReport可以从http://sourceforge.net/projects/ireport/下载安装,包括iReport-2.0.3-windows-installer.exe和iReport-2.0.3.zip两种安装方式。
配置环境
在使用iReport之前,需要配置好JBuilder2005和Ms-SqlServer2000环境,并将iReport安装到本地用户的ClassPath中。
制作简单报表
1. 配置数据库的JDBC连接,添加三个jar包到本地用户的ClassPath:msbase.jar、mssqlserver.jar和msutil.jar。
2. 设置iReport的使用语言和报表输出路径,在【Options】->【选项】里的【General】选项卡里选择中文(中国),并勾选【Compiler】选项卡里的【编译在报表数据夹】。
3. 新建一个报表文档,单击【档案】->【开启新档】。
4. 配置数据库连接,选择【Data】->【连接/资料来源】菜单,设置JDBC连接参数。
5. 新建报表查询,选择【Data】->【报表查询】菜单,输入SQL语句。
6. 报表查询的报表参数,通过【预览】->【报表参数】添加查询的参数。
7. 放置列标题和详细信息,工具栏里面放置了常用的报表元素,包括文字、直方图、饼图、分组报表等等。
8. 选择生成文件格式,编译、生成报表,iReport提供了多种输出格式,包括pdf、html等。
其他开源报表制作软件
除了iReport之外,还有其他开源报表制作软件,例如JFreeChart、ReportJet、Chart2D等。这些软件都可以用于设计和生成各种复杂报表。